if you mean spoof.. the answer is yes

if you think in CFW 3.60 ..... NO.

if you spoof you 3.55 that does not mean it is a CFW 3.60.


at this time there is not a 3.60 CFW

if you are looking to play games that require 3.60 FW to play in 3.55 CFW , then you need to edit the eboot and param.sfo or search in the net for one already edited. Smile

If it's asking for 3.60 or later that means you're already on 3.60? You can't downgrade from factory/service mode because we don't have the signed lv1/ lv2diag files. The PS3 checks the ecsda key as well as the fw number, so if the key doesn't match it won't work no matter what you make the fw version.
